Antioquia Authorities Evict Illegal Miners from Continental Gold’s Veta Sur Operations

Published: January 20, 2016 |

[Click image to enlarge]

National and regional police authorities in Buriticá, Antioquia launched a significant operation to evict illegal miners from unsafe areas near Continental Gold Inc.‘s Veta Sur operations in the Buriticá town during the weekend. The National Mining Agency has ordered local authorities, with the participation of Continental as the legal title holder in the area, to formally close down those illegal operations as a preventative measure in light of the danger from potential landslides and the collapsing of tunnels in areas of illegal mining activity. A security council, led by the Buriticá Major and the regional police commander, is in the process of issuing the corresponding eviction orders to remove the miners from several illegal mines in the area. So far miners have been leaving their tunnels peacefully.

The company’s operations are unaffected. The company´s management and technical teams are on site ready to cooperate with the authorities in the orderly implementation of the government´s orders and to close down several illegal mines.

“Illegal mining is endemic to areas with high-grade gold deposits in Colombia, as it has been throughout history elsewhere in the world. The Colombian government has declared ‘war on criminal mining’ and is deploying its resources to control the activity in various parts of the country. Continental works in very close coordination with the authorities in its area of influence in that regard, as well as protecting our people and assets,” said Leon Teicher, executive chairman of the board.

“Despite the regional emergency of this situation, we think it is a positive sign of the direction of the joint work between the Colombian government and the legitimate owners of titles, especially where projects of national strategic interest, such as Continental’s Buriticá Project, are being developed and operated,” added Teicher.


About Continental Gold
Continental Gold Inc. is an advanced-stage exploration and development company with an extensive portfolio of 100 percent-owned gold projects in Colombia. Formed in April 2007, the company — led by an international management team with a successful track record of discovering and developing large high-grade gold deposits in Latin America — is focused on advancing its high-grade Buriticá gold project to production.
